The exchange of wedding rings is one of the most heartwarming and moving moments of the ceremony, not least because the gesture has long been symbolic of the unity and commitment of lifelong matrimonial partnership. Indeed, the first wedding rings can be traced back to the Ancient Egyptians, who exchanged rings made from braided reeds and hemp, and the Ancient Greeks and Romans, who wore rings crafted from leather, bone or ivory, before metal bands in iron, gold and silver started being worn.

In the past, wedding rings signified a promise or contract between a couple and their two families, while today they have evolved into statements of individuality and partnership. However, the significance of wearing wedding bands remains the same – a symbol of love and devotion – and when it comes to shopping for wedding bands, both partners choose their own ring.

The first consideration when selecting your wedding bands should be personal style – you are likely to wear it almost every day, so choose something that represents you and expresses your individuality. Most people require their wedding band to match other jewellery or watches they already own, so it’s worth thinking about whether you prefer yellow or white gold, and if you favour traditional or modern designs.

It’s important to factor in how the wedding band will look next to the engagement ring, as they will be stacked alongside each other. A wedding band should complement the engagement ring without overshadowing it.
